
MATTHEW A. "MATT" PATE
Matthew A. “Matt” Pate, 28, of Baytown, was born June 24, 1974, in Toledo, OH and passed away Sunday, October 13, 2002, at his home.
He was a 1992 graduate of Ross S. Sterling High School in Baytown, where he lettered all four years as a goalie for the boy”s water polo team and medalled in various swimming events. He also participated in the Junior Olympic water polo games and had the distinction of being selected an All American goalie. An employee of Exxon Chemicals, he was an avid reader and sports fan. Matt was a generous and giving person who made those around him feel better.
